Overview
The Risk and Post Market Surveillance (PMS) Manager reports to the Quality Director and leads a team of Quality Associates. The role is responsible for developing and maintaining IVDR compliant Risk Management and PMS files across MBD's culture media, AST, ID and product portfolios.
Responsibilities
- Driving development and maintenance of IVDR compliant Risk Management and PMS files across MBD's culture media, AST, ID and associated product portfolios.
- Ensuring quality and content of all Risk Management and PMS files for the Division.
- Managing the program to ensure files are reviewed in line with regulatory requirements.
- Managing the trending of complaints for the Division.
- Setting direction and goals for the team; acting as Divisional Risk Management and PMS Lead and expert in risk management file creation.
- Efficiently reallocating and balancing resources in line with changing priorities to keep files current within defined review periods.
- Cultivating strong working relationships with colleagues across locations to obtain information for risk management file compilation.
- Ensuring common standards for Risk Management and PMS files across all product groups and locations.
- Managing and communicating progress to the Quality Director and other key stakeholders, highlighting areas of risk and uncertainty.
- Planning and executing tasks for self and direct reports to keep all files maintained in current status.
- Anticipating and raising issues that could impact compliance in a timely manner, offering solutions for consideration.
- Supporting the Project Management team in relation to Risk Management files for new product development.
- Pro-actively seeking process improvements in line with the company's PPI Business System.
- Providing metrics as required for relevant business and quality reviews.
- Fulfilling responsibilities as defined in the Divisional Health, Safety and Environmental policies and associated Codes of Practice.
- Role modeling leadership to a team of four Quality Associates.
- Effectively hiring, managing, coaching and appraising the team to enable development and full potential.
- Creating and maintaining a team structure to best meet business needs while optimizing resources.
